French dairy processor Bongrain has confirmed it is in talks with dairy co-operative Terra Lacta over a potential partnership deal.

A spokesperson for Bongrain told just-food today (17 October) that discussions had taken place and were ongoing, but that nothing, as yet, had been decided upon.

It is understood the talks surround the possibility of setting up a joint venture in the Poitou-Charentes region of south-western France for the supply of its milk, butter and cream.

The spokesperson said a decision on any joint-venture is unlikely to made before the end of the year.

In August, Bongrain booked a drop in first-half profits after the company recorded an impairment charge on its Spanish operations.
